如何搭建svn远程服务器

worktile 其他 133

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    搭建SVN远程服务器可以按照以下步骤进行操作:

    步骤一:选择合适的操作系统和版本。
    首先,选择一个适合的操作系统来搭建远程SVN服务器。常见的操作系统有Windows、Linux、MacOS等。根据自己的需求和熟悉程度选择合适的操作系统和版本。

    步骤二:安装SVN软件。
    在选择好操作系统后,需要安装SVN软件。SVN有多种选择,比如TortoiseSVN、VisualSVN等。根据操作系统和个人需要选择合适的软件,并按照软件提供的安装步骤进行安装。

    步骤三:创建SVN远程服务器仓库。
    安装完SVN软件后,需要在远程服务器上创建一个仓库来存储代码。在SVN软件中,一般有创建仓库的功能或命令。根据软件的具体操作步骤,创建一个空的仓库。

    步骤四:配置SVN远程服务器。
    在创建仓库之后,需要配置SVN远程服务器的相关参数。配置的内容包括仓库的访问权限、用户的身份验证等。可以根据具体的需求和安全考虑进行配置。

    步骤五:启动SVN远程服务器。
    在完成配置之后,需要启动SVN远程服务器,让其可以接受来自客户端的连接。启动服务器的方法也因软件而异,可以查阅相关文档或使用命令行来启动。

    步骤六:测试连接SVN远程服务器。
    在启动服务器之后,可以使用客户端工具来进行连接测试。比如使用TortoiseSVN等工具,输入远程服务器的地址和仓库的路径,然后进行连接。如果连接成功,说明服务器已经搭建完成。

    总结:
    以上就是搭建SVN远程服务器的步骤。需要注意的是,在搭建之前要选择合适的操作系统和SVN软件,并按照具体的软件要求进行安装和配置。在搭建完成后,可以通过客户端工具进行连接测试,以确保服务器可以正常运行。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建SVN远程服务器可以通过以下步骤进行:

    1. 确定服务器平台:首先需要确定要在哪种操作系统上搭建SVN远程服务器,例如Windows、Linux等。

    2. 安装SVN服务器软件:根据所选操作系统类型,下载并安装相应版本的SVN服务器软件。常用的SVN服务器软件包括Apache Subversion(通常简称为SVN)和VisualSVN Server。

    3. 配置服务器:在安装完SVN服务器软件后,需要进行一些配置来使其正常运行。配置包括指定仓库存储位置、创建用户账户、设置权限等。具体的配置方法可以参考SVN服务器软件的官方文档或相关教程。

    4. 创建SVN仓库:在服务器上创建SVN仓库,仓库是存放版本控制数据的地方。可以使用SVN服务器软件提供的命令行工具或图形化界面工具来创建仓库。创建仓库后,可以为其指定密码访问控制、设置Web界面等。

    5. 配置客户端:在搭建好SVN远程服务器后,需要在客户端上配置SVN。客户端可以是命令行工具(如TortoiseSVN、SVN命令行工具)或集成开发环境(如Eclipse、Visual Studio等)。配置方式包括指定仓库URL、设置认证信息等。

    6. 远程访问:完成上述步骤后,可以通过远程访问来使用SVN。通过客户端工具提交更新、查看历史记录、比较差异等操作。有时可能需要配置防火墙和端口转发以允许远程访问。

    总结:搭建SVN远程服务器需要选择适合的操作系统平台,安装SVN服务器软件并进行配置,创建SVN仓库,配置客户端,最后进行远程访问。这些步骤是实施该过程的基础,但具体的操作可能因操作系统和SVN服务器软件的版本而有所不同,建议参考相关官方文档或教程进行详细操作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    搭建SVN远程服务器可以按照以下步骤进行:

    步骤一:选择合适的服务器系统
    首先,你需要选择一个适合搭建SVN远程服务器的操作系统。常见的选择包括Linux、Windows和macOS。每个操作系统都有各自的优缺点,你需要根据自己的需求和熟悉程度做出选择。

    步骤二:安装SVN服务器软件
    根据你选择的操作系统,下载并安装对应的SVN服务器软件。对于Linux系统,可以选择安装Apache Subversion(简称SVN),通过以下命令安装SVN:

    sudo apt-get install subversion
    

    对于Windows系统,可以选择安装VisualSVN Server,它是一个易于安装和管理的SVN服务器软件。

    步骤三:创建SVN仓库
    接下来,你需要创建SVN仓库。SVN仓库是用于存放项目代码的地方。通过以下命令,在服务器上创建一个新的SVN仓库:

    sudo svnadmin create /path/to/repository
    

    请将“/path/to/repository”替换为你希望存放SVN仓库的路径。

    步骤四:配置SVN用户
    为了访问SVN仓库,你需要为用户设置用户名和密码。通过以下命令,在SVN仓库路径下创建一个名为“conf”的文件夹,并在此文件夹中创建一个名为“passwd”的文件。

    sudo mkdir /path/to/repository/conf
    sudo htpasswd -c /path/to/repository/conf/passwd username
    

    请将“/path/to/repository”替换为你的SVN仓库路径,将“username”替换为你希望设置的用户名。运行上述命令后,会要求你输入密码并确认。

    步骤五:配置访问权限
    你可以根据需要为不同的用户或用户组设置不同的访问权限。通过以下命令,在“conf”文件夹中创建一个名为“authz”的文件。

    sudo touch /path/to/repository/conf/authz
    

    使用文本编辑器打开“authz”文件,并根据需要配置访问权限。

    步骤六:启动SVN服务器
    完成上述步骤后,你可以启动SVN服务器,让用户可以访问SVN仓库。通过以下命令启动SVN服务器:

    sudo svnserve -d -r /path/to/repository
    

    请将“/path/to/repository”替换为你的SVN仓库路径。

    步骤七:配置SVN客户端
    现在,你可以在客户端上配置SVN客户端,以便连接到SVN远程服务器。根据你的客户端操作系统不同,可选择不同的SVN客户端,如TortoiseSVN、Cornerstone等。

    在配置SVN客户端时,你需要指定SVN服务器的地址、用户名和密码,以便连接到SVN远程服务器。

    至此,你已经成功搭建好了SVN远程服务器。现在,你可以使用SVN客户端来访问和管理SVN仓库中的代码了。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部